## How Dispatchly Picks a Driver

Quick heads-up for whoever inherits this: the driver-assignment heuristic isn't ML, it's a weighted score — proximity (50%), current load (30%), historical on-time rate (20%). Ties go to whoever's been idle longest. Don't "fix" the idle tiebreaker; it keeps the Harlowe depot drivers from revolting. Tuning weights requires the sealed config in the ops vault, and unsealing it means entering the recovery passphrase noted immediately below.

vault phrase of tajeg-tageg = pelix-druix-holius-briael-zorwyn-frawyn-fraox-norok-drueth-aldiel

Ticket: FAC — Night-shift access, support team

Location: Dunmere Tower, Level 1
Requested by: Support team lead

Reception to note: support team moving to 24/7 coverage starting next week. Night staff will arrive between 22:00 and 23:30 via the rear lobby. Main turnstiles are powered down overnight, so reception should direct all after-hours arrivals to the rear keypad door. Do not issue temporary badges for this; the standing arrangement covers it. The rear keypad door code for night-shift entry is as follows.

turnstile pass: bdg-QZV-3

# Break-glass: Lanternsite incremental rebuilds

Hey on-call — if Lanternsite's incremental static rebuilds wedge (stale pages everywhere, build queue stuck), you can break glass and force a full rebuild from the Coldmere control node. Only do this after two failed incremental retries; a full rebuild takes ~25 minutes and blocks partial deploys. The control node prompts for emergency credentials before it'll accept the force flag, so enter the passphrase below.

vault phrase of kawep-tahog = ulaix-briath

FAQ — Why do totals in the HaulerMetrics fuel-usage report differ from raw telemetry?

The report aggregates fuel draws per vehicle per calendar day in the depot's local timezone, while raw telemetry is stored in UTC. Reviewers checking the aggregation code should note that records straddling midnight are assigned to the day the trip started, not ended. Rounding happens once, at the daily level, to two decimals. The full specification, including edge cases for split shifts and idle burn, is documented on the internal page here:

runbook for tafof-yawif: https://confluence.tolvaqsys.internal/display/display/browse/pages/7be3